Overview

Postcode GU21 4QF is located in a major urban area, within the Horsell ward of Woking in the South East region, and forms part of the Woking Central area. It has very low deprivation and low crime levels, with around 43 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 49% below the South East average of 84 per 1,000. The average income per household in Woking Central is £67,979 per year. The nearest station is Woking, about 0.6 miles away. There are 5 primary and 1 secondary schools in the area. There are 2 parks nearby, the closest small park is Elizabeth II jubilee park.
